    Rashid Khan has ripped through Zimbabwe in Sharjah to give Afghanistan a great chance of going 2-1 up in the series. Once he broke the counter-attacking partnership between Sikandar Raza and Craig Ervine, it was all one-way traffic as the young legspinner demolished the middle and lower order. Mujeeb Zadran also chipped in with three wickets as the tourists failed to cope with the Afghan spin duo.     That was yet another utterly one-sided affair in Sharjah, continuing the theme of this series so far. Rashid Khan and Mujeeb Zadran took eight wickets between them to run through Zimbabwe for just 154, the tourists having no answer for the skilfull spin-duo. The former took five wickets for just 24 runs in a parsimonious spell, running through the lower order with seeming ease. The hosts then took the aggressive approach to the small target, and although it cost them a few wickets they cantered home in the end. Half centuries from Rahmat Shah and Nasir Jamal ensured Afghanistan take a 2-1 lead in the series.
